The Department of Biomolecular Engineering [https://www.soe.ucsc.edu/departments/biomolecular-engineering] at UC Santa Cruz (UCSC) invites applications from outstanding scientists for the position of Assistant Research Scientist, under the direction of Professor Mark Akeson. We seek a self-motivated, creative scientist interested in genomics and transcriptomics technologies. Specific projects in which the candidate will play a significant role include the following: i) the development of nanopore sequencing technology; ii) the development of nanopore based methods for characterizing epigenetic modifications and modifications to RNA molecules; iii) single cell methods; and iv) novel nanopore based sequencing technologies, using PromethION and MinION.

The incumbent will be expected (i) to provide technical leadership and direction to a small senior-level technology development team, (ii) to work with graduate and undergraduate students, (iii) publish in scientific journals and present findings at scientific meetings, and (iv) be expected to apply for and serve as principal investigator on grants, contracts, and private external funding. The successful candidate will be highly articulate and have demonstrated ability to collaborate with scientists, laboratory scientists, software engineers, and students in developing novel genomics tools, protocols, and resources.
